如何突破网盘限速壁垒?解析高速下载的底层逻辑
在数字化时代,云存储已成为我们工作和生活中不可或缺的一部分。然而,大多数网盘服务商对非会员用户施加的下载速度限制,常常让我们在获取重要文件时倍感 frustration。网盘加速技术,特别是直链下载技术,为解决这一痛点提供了创新方案。本文将从技术原理到实际应用,全面解析直链下载技术如何帮助用户突破限速壁垒,提升云盘资源获取效率,为不同场景下的用户提供实用的高速下载解决方案。
问题引入:网盘限速的技术困局与用户痛点
限速机制的技术原理
网盘服务商通常采用基于用户账户类型的带宽控制策略,通过QoS(服务质量)机制对不同等级用户分配差异化的网络资源。非会员用户的下载请求会被服务器端的流量控制模块识别并限制在较低的带宽范围内,通常为100-500KB/s,这种限制直接影响了云盘资源获取的效率。
用户面临的实际困境
在日常使用中,用户经常遭遇以下问题:一个2GB的文件需要数小时才能下载完成;高峰期下载频繁中断;批量下载时速度叠加受限。这些问题不仅浪费时间,更影响了工作效率和用户体验,尤其是对于需要频繁获取大型文件的专业用户和企业团队。
方案解析:直链下载技术的底层工作机制
直链解析的核心原理
直链解析(直接获取文件真实URL的技术手段)通过绕过网盘服务商的前端页面和API限制,直接定位到文件在云存储服务器上的实际存储位置。这一过程主要包括三个步骤:首先解析网盘页面中的加密文件信息,然后模拟会员用户的请求头信息,最后生成包含有效访问令牌的直接下载链接。
技术实现的关键挑战
直链下载技术面临两大核心挑战:一是网盘平台的反爬机制,包括动态令牌生成和IP频率限制;二是文件地址的时效性控制,大多数直链链接仅在短时间内有效。优秀的直链工具需要持续更新解析算法以应对平台的技术升级,同时优化链接生成策略以延长有效时间窗口。
价值呈现:直链方案 vs 传统下载方式
性能对比分析
| 评估维度 | 传统下载方式 | 直链下载方案 | 提升幅度 |
|---|---|---|---|
| 平均下载速度 | 100-500KB/s | 5-20MB/s | 10-40倍 |
| 操作步骤 | 5-8步 | 2-3步 | 减少60% |
| 稳定性 | 易受高峰期影响 | 相对稳定 | 提升70% |
| 资源占用 | 高(需运行网页) | 低(仅需下载器) | 降低50% |
下载速度可视化对比
下载速度提升:🅱️传统方式(100-500KB/s) 🔵直链方案(5-20MB/s)
实践指南:直链下载工具的部署与配置
环境准备
- 浏览器环境:推荐使用Chrome或Firefox最新版本
- 用户脚本管理器:安装Tampermonkey扩展程序
- 下载工具:建议配置IDM(Internet Download Manager)或Aria2作为下载器
工具获取与安装
- 获取项目源码:
git clone https://gitcode.com/GitHub_Trending/on/Online-disk-direct-link-download-assistant
- 脚本导入步骤:
- 打开Tampermonkey控制面板
- 点击"创建新脚本"
- 复制项目中"(改)网盘直链下载助手.user.js"文件内容
- 保存并启用脚本
基础配置优化
- 下载器关联设置:在脚本配置界面选择已安装的下载工具
- 线程数调整:根据网络状况设置合理的下载线程(建议8-16线程)
- 链接有效期设置:根据文件大小调整链接超时时间(大文件建议设为15分钟)
场景应用:三级分类下的直链技术应用
个人用户场景
- 媒体资源管理:高效下载高清影视、音乐专辑和游戏安装包
- 个人备份恢复:快速获取云端备份的重要个人文件
- 学习资料获取:加速下载在线课程视频和电子书资源
专业用户场景
- 设计师资源库:快速获取大型设计素材和源文件
- 程序员开发资源:高效下载开发工具、SDK和代码库
- 科研工作者:加速获取学术论文和研究数据
企业应用场景
- 团队文件共享:提升跨部门大文件传输效率
- 远程办公支持:加速获取远程工作所需的项目资源
- 培训资料分发:高效部署企业内部培训视频和文档
进阶技巧:优化配置与问题排查
多线程下载参数优化指南
- 网络带宽评估:使用测速工具确定实际可用带宽
- 线程数计算公式:建议线程数 = 可用带宽(MB/s) × 2
- 分块大小设置:大文件(>1GB)建议分块大小为10-20MB
不同网络环境下的配置建议
- 家庭宽带环境:启用最大线程数,设置较长超时时间
- 移动网络环境:降低线程数(4-8线程),启用断点续传
- 企业内网环境:根据内网带宽限制调整并发数,避免影响其他业务
常见错误排查
-
链接生成失败
- 检查脚本是否为最新版本
- 清除浏览器缓存和Cookie
- 确认目标文件未被原网盘限制分享
-
下载速度不稳定
- 尝试更换下载时段,避开网络高峰期
- 调整线程数和分块大小
- 检查防火墙设置是否阻止了下载连接
-
链接有效期过短
- 减少同时下载的文件数量
- 选择在服务器负载较低时段下载
- 启用链接自动刷新功能
工具选择决策流程图
graph TD
A[选择直链下载工具] --> B{使用场景}
B -->|个人轻度使用| C[浏览器脚本+默认下载器]
B -->|专业频繁使用| D[独立客户端+IDM]
B -->|企业批量需求| E[服务器版+Aria2]
C --> F[检查浏览器兼容性]
D --> G[配置多线程参数]
E --> H[设置分布式下载节点]
F --> I[完成配置]
G --> I
H --> I
总结:直链下载技术的价值与发展趋势
直链下载技术通过绕过传统下载渠道的限制,为用户提供了一种高效、稳定的云盘资源获取方式。随着云存储技术的不断发展,直链下载工具也在持续进化,未来可能会整合更多AI优化算法,实现智能带宽分配和动态资源调度。对于用户而言,掌握直链下载技术不仅能够突破当前的限速壁垒,更能提升整个数字资源管理的效率和体验。建议用户根据自身需求选择合适的工具配置,并关注技术更新以应对网盘平台的策略变化。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ust081-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
Hy3-previewHy3 preview 是由腾讯混元团队研发的2950亿参数混合专家(Mixture-of-Experts, MoE)模型,包含210亿激活参数和38亿MTP层参数。Hy3 preview是在我们重构的基础设施上训练的首款模型,也是目前发布的性能最强的模型。该模型在复杂推理、指令遵循、上下文学习、代码生成及智能体任务等方面均实现了显著提升。Python00